Beginner level

Description

In this lesson, students learn to form third person questions and answers related to origins, names, cities, and countries.

Main Aims

  • To practice language used for forming questions and answers in the context of nationality, origin, name

Subsidiary Aims

  • To provide review of contractions in the context of where is, what is, it is
  • To provide fluency speaking practice in pronunciation of `s` as either /z/ or /s/ in the context of where´s, what´s, it´s

Procedure

Lead-in (1-2 minutes) • to introduce myself

Write on board: What´s my name? Have students answer Write on board: Where am I from? Have students guess

Map game (5-10 minutes) • to review third person answers in the context of origin and names

Hand out copies from of map from page 13 of New Headway Beginner. Have students work individually on filling out the map. Play recording Track 19 from NHB CD to help students check their answers.

Elicit and drill name and origin (3-5 minutes) • to review third person questions and contractions

Put two pictures (1 man, 1 woman). Elicit ´what´s her/his name´ and ´where´s s/he from´ Drill on board with corresponding contractions.

Questions and answers pair work (5-10 minutes) • to have students practice third person questions and answers

Divide students into pairs: a-b, a-b, a-b, a-(T). give As picture of black woman (Sally from South Africa) and white guy (Tim from Scotland). give Bs picture of white woman (Becca from Italy) and asian man (Carl from Japan). Have them practice asking and answering in with their partners

Elicit and drill city and country (1-2 minutes) • to get students comfortable with the vocab city and country

Right on board ´Istanbul´ and ´Turkey.´ ask: what´s Istanbul? what´s Turkey?

Group work! Cities and country (5-10 minutes) • to get students practicing: where´s? it´s in

Put two desks together in the middle of the room. Divide the class into two groups. Give one 3/4 (depending on group size) cities and 3/4 countries. Demonstrate: where´s Barcelona? it´s in Spain. Have students from first group put down one city at a time and ask: where´s? other student put down matching country by saying: it´s in

Fill in the blank - faces and places • make sure the every single student can form name and origin questions

Handout print out from NHB pages 14-15, 140-141. Demonstrate by asking student: What´s her name?´ ´Where´s she from? for #1. Have each student ask for one picture while the whole class writes down the name and origin of the person in the picture.

Flex activity: Presentations (10-15 minutes) • make sure every student can answer questions related to origin and name

Hand each student an empty scrap paper. Ask them to draw someone. Have each student come up and answer: what´s her/his name? where´s s/he from?
